Job Description
We are looking for a detail-oriented and proactive QA Engineer to join our software quality assurance team. The ideal candidate will have hands-on experience testing web and mobile applications, identifying issues, and ensuring high-quality product releases. You will collaborate closely with developers, designers, product managers, and project teams to deliver stable and reliable software.
The role requires strong knowledge of testing methodologies, bug tracking tools, and both manual and automated testing practices. Experience with API testing, automation frameworks, and CI/CD environments is highly desirable.
Key Responsibilities
Design, develop, and execute manual and automated test cases for web and mobile applications.
Perform functional, regression, integration, system, smoke, and user acceptance testing.
Identify, document, and track defects using tools like Jira, Trello, or Azure DevOps.
Collaborate with developers and product teams to reproduce, analyze, and resolve bugs.